Deploy step 4 — SquatSentry scanner. Provision the worker VM, pull the latest scanner image, and copy env.template to .env. Set SCAN_INTERVAL and REGISTRY_MIRROR first. Do not enable the cron unit until the env file is complete. The registry-polling token that authorizes package metadata reads goes on the line directly after this note.

vault entry, yahif-yajep: COURIER_KEY29=b802bdf8034096b65a51c6ba5abe2

## Onboarding: Soft Deletes in Orders

At Cartfield, orders are never hard-deleted. Cancelled or purged orders get a `deleted_at` timestamp and vanish from customer views, but support tooling can still retrieve them for thirty days. Use the restore panel rather than SQL. The restore panel connects to the archive service using a credential that must appear in your env file on the next line:

sealed setting: ARCHIVE_KEY3=8d0

Subject: Handover — Penника receipts mailer

Taking over Givewick donation-receipt mailer releases from me as of Friday. Pipeline is green, v1.9 shipped Tuesday, nothing pending. Only gotcha: the mailer templates are signed separately from the app bundle, and staging won't accept unsigned templates. Everything else is in the runbook. For signing the next template release, use the key below.

release key, fajop-fahof: bky19_e81kW8mKnKvqQ6eSnkx